Spring常用註解

2021-10-01 21:03:49 字數 667 閱讀 7877

(

"/queryportfoliolist"

)public pmsresult

>

queryportfoliolist

(@requestparam

(required =

true

) string createdby,

@requestparam

(required =

false

) string type,

@requestparam

(required =

false

) string strategyid,

@requestparam

(required =

false

) string portfolioname

)可以通過required=false或者true來要求@requestparam配置的前端引數是否一定要傳,required=false表示不傳的話,會給引數賦值為null,required=true就是必須要有 若不傳則報錯。

如果@requestparam註解的引數是int型別,並且required=false,此時如果不傳引數的話,會報錯。原因是,required=false時,不傳引數的話,會給引數賦值null,這樣就會把null賦值給了int,因此會報錯。

Spring常用註解

spring常用註解 1 引入context命名空間 在spring的配置檔案中 配置檔案如下 xml xmlns context spring context 2.5.xsd 開啟配置 spring 會自動掃瞄cn.pic包下面有註解的類,完成bean的裝配。xml xmlversion 1.0 ...

Spring常用註解

在spring中常用的註解 autowired註解 不推薦使用,建議使用 resource autowired可以對成員變數 方法和建構函式進行標註,來完成自動裝配的工作。autowired的標註位置不同,它們都會在spring在初始化這個bean時,自動裝配這個屬性。要使 autowired能夠工...

spring常用註解

1 引入context命名空間 在spring的配置檔案中 配置檔案如下 xml 收藏 xmlns context spring context 2.5.xsd 開啟配置 spring 會自動掃瞄cn.pic包下面有註解的類,完成bean的裝配。xml xmlns xmlns xsi xmlns c...